remove query parameters on refresh

This commit is contained in:
mlsmaycon
2026-02-10 21:53:18 +01:00
parent 95d672c9df
commit f22497d5da
4 changed files with 17 additions and 3 deletions

View File

@@ -7,7 +7,7 @@ import { PoweredByNetBird } from "@/components/PoweredByNetBird";
import { StatusCard } from "@/components/StatusCard";
import type { ErrorData } from "@/data";
export function ErrorPage({ code, title, message, proxy = true, destination = true, requestId, simple = false }: ErrorData) {
export function ErrorPage({ code, title, message, proxy = true, destination = true, requestId, simple = false, retryUrl }: ErrorData) {
useEffect(() => {
document.title = `${title} - NetBird Service`;
}, [title]);
@@ -38,7 +38,7 @@ export function ErrorPage({ code, title, message, proxy = true, destination = tr
{/* Buttons */}
<div className="flex gap-3 justify-center items-center mb-6 z-10 relative">
<Button variant="primary" onClick={() => window.location.reload()}>
<Button variant="primary" onClick={() => retryUrl ? window.location.href = retryUrl : window.location.reload()}>
<RotateCw size={16} />
Refresh Page
</Button>